The Rolling School offers an extraordinary free educational program for women in rural areas. 

Because many young women in the rural areas are put into work at a far too early age in life, they have never had the opportunity for a proper education and now are struggling with illiteracy as an adult.

According to UNICEF, poverty, early marriage, cultural barriers, distance from schools, inadequate sanitation facilities, a lack of female teachers, and safety concerns on the way to school are among the factors contributing to low female education rates in rural areas. Another factor is the need for girls to perform household chores, which makes it difficult for them to physically attend school for an extended period, and in many rural areas there are simply no schools for miles around.
